Im wondering when connecting a zap between our estimating software to our email for follow up emails a few days later. Knowing that it pulls the relevant example from the program to use for a test, does an actual follow up email get sent out to the example e-mail? For example, I set up a zap to send out a follow up email 3 days later after sending the estimate for landscaping work. But we had gotten a copy of the follow up email sent and it shows the test email (being one of our old prospects that didnt go with the work). Hope this makes sense. Thanks 

Best answer by Troy Tessalone

@Rooted Landscape

If the Zap step test was successful, then the provided test data would have been used to perform the live action.

 

For example, if you have a Gmail Send Email step, and you input your email address, then test that step, you will receive the email.
